Typhoon Helmets Snell SA2020 DOT Certified Full Face Helmet
The Typhoon helmet is a dual-certified option, meeting both Snell SA2020 and DOT FMVSS 218 standards. This means it’s not only suitable for racing but also legal for street use, offering versatility for drivers who want one helmet for multiple purposes. The Kevlar chin strap with D-ring closure adds durability and security.
The 3mm optically correct hard-coated face shield features eyeport gaskets to keep out dust and debris, and the plush interior with rear exhaust vents enhances comfort during long sessions. Fire-retardant liner materials provide an extra layer of safety. If you need a helmet that works both on the track and the street, this is a strong contender.

Buyer’s Guide: What to Consider
Choosing the right SA2020 helmet involves more than just picking a color. Consider certification, shell material, HANS compatibility, visor features, and fit. This guide helps you navigate these factors to make an informed decision.
- Certification Standards: Snell SA2020 and SA2025 are the current standards for auto racing helmets. SA2025 is the latest and may be required by some organizations, while SA2020 is still accepted in many series. Always check your racing body's requirements before purchasing.
- Shell Material: Helmets are made from fiberglass, fiber-reinforced plastic (FRP), or composite materials. Lighter shells reduce neck fatigue, but ensure they still meet safety standards. Fiberglass offers a good balance of weight and strength.
- HANS Compatibility: If you use a HANS device, look for helmets with M6 threaded inserts. These allow you to attach the device securely. Some helmets include inserts, while others require separate purchase.
- Visor Features: Consider the visor's thickness, anti-scratch coating, and sunshade film. A 3mm shield offers durability, and a sunshade reduces glare. Tear-off posts are useful for racing in dirty conditions.
- Fit and Comfort: Measure your head circumference and refer to the size chart. A snug fit is essential for safety, but the interior padding should be comfortable. Look for fire-retardant liners and ventilation for long sessions.
